Prevent Freezing and Bursting Pipes
All house owners who live in temperate environments must do their ideal to winterize their pipelines. Failure to do so can lead to catastrophe like frozen, fractured, or ruptured pipes.

Attempt a Hair Dryer or Heat Gun


When your pipes are almost freezing, your trusty hair clothes dryer or heat weapon is a godsend. Bowling warm air directly right into them might assist if the hot towels do not assist remove any kind of resolving ice in your pipelines. Do not utilize other things that create straight flames like a blow torch. This can lead to a larger calamity that you can not control. You might end up damaging your pipelines while attempting to thaw the ice. And in the future, you might even end up shedding your home. So be cautious!

Open Closet Doors Hiding Plumbing


When it's chilly outside, it would be practical to open up closet doors that are masking your pipelines. Doing this tiny method can maintain your pipes warm and restrict the possibly harmful outcomes of freezing temperatures.

Require Time to Cover Exposed Water Lines


One cool and also very easy hack to heat up frigid pipes is to cover them with cozy towels. You can also utilize pre-soaked towels in warm water, just do not fail to remember to put on protective handwear covers to safeguard your hands from the warm.

Switch on the Faucets


When the temperature level drops as well as it appears as if the icy temperature level will last, it will help to turn on your water both inside and also outdoors. This will certainly maintain the water streaming via your plumbing systems. You'll end up throwing away gallons of water this means.

When Pipes are Frozen, close Off Water


Shut off the main water shutoff promptly if you see that your pipelines are entirely icy or practically nearing that phase. You will typically locate this in your basement or laundry room near the heating system or the front wall closest to the street. Transform it off as soon as possible to avoid further damage.
With more water, more ice will pile up, which will at some point lead to rupture pipes. If you are unsure regarding the state of your pipelines this winter months, it is best to call a professional plumber for an examination.

10 Things People Unknowingly Do That Can Ruin Plumbing System


Disregarding the Limitations of Your Garbage Disposal


Many people fail to understand that garbage disposal is not a substitute for a trash can. You should never put down things like potato, onion peels and coffee grounds in the drain. These things can either ruin the blades of the garbage disposal or result in a clog in the drain.


Flushing Things in the Toilet


Are you conveniently flushing tissue paper, cotton swabs or hygiene products? You need to STOP doing this with immediate effect!



The toilet is meant only to flush pee and poop. Never flush other things down because they will eventually clog your drain or sewer. This rule applies to things which we claim to be biodegradable too.


Failing to Winter-Proof Your Plumbing


Do you face frequent pipe bursts in the winter season? It may be out of your own fault rather than nature’s spell on your plumbing.



Always remember to disconnect all outdoor hoses and pipe connections before winter approaches to save the pipes from freezing. You may even need to get your plumbing insulated to save it from extremely cold temperatures.


Ignoring the Condition of Your Dishwasher and Washing Machine Hoses


Most hoses for dishwashers and washing machines wear out soon after 5-6 years of use. Unfortunately, a worn-out hose bursts suddenly without much prior warning signs. It’s advisable to replace the hoses every 5 years to prevent sudden unexpected mishaps.
